<title>Double Mastectomy Isn&#8217;t Slowing Down Shelley Ross</title>
<description><![CDATA[<p><img class="alignright size-full wp-image-179930" title="ShelleyRoss" src="http://www.mediabistro.com/tvnewser/files/2013/05/06_shelleyross_lgl.jpg" alt="" width="250" height="375" />Add <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Shelley-Ross-profile.html">Shelley Ross</a></strong>’ name to the growing list of disciples of the Sisterhood of St. Angelina.</p>
<p>Ross, former executive producer of ABC’s &#8220;Good Morning America&#8221; and CBS&#8217; &#8220;Early Show,&#8221; underwent a double mastectomy last month after discovering that she, too, carried the BRCA gene, which greatly increases the risk of developing breast cancer.</p>
<p>Ross says it was Jolie’s stunning Op Ed in the New York Times last Tuesday that convinced her to go public, the same day, via her blog, <a href="http://shelleyzross.com/2013/05/14/the-sisterhood-of-st-angelina/" target="_blank">daily Xpress</a>.</p>
<p>“I was literally shocked when I read about her,” Ross, 60, says. “I thought what she did was so smart. It’s an opportunity to expand the dialogue. Like her, I was able to write down all the details. Nobody can interpret this as if I’m dying.”</p>
<p>In this case, “nobody” is Ross’ code for media, which over the years has run some brutal (mostly anonymous) slams against the producer. Still, it was common knowledge that Ross’ uber-intensity had alienated her from many of her coworkers.</p>
<p>Says Ross: “I got the shit end of the stick from the media. It was like a feeding frenzy.”</p>
<p>With her mastectomy, Ross was determined not to repeat that experience, so she told no one outside a small group of friends. They kept her secret, she says.</p>
<p>“My real concern, to be perfectly honest, was with outlets … that have printed false, libelous, damaging, actionable reports, regardless of what I tried to correct,” says Ross.</p>
<p>“If it [mastectomy] got out to what is certainly a small handful of detractors, I would have read about some anonymous person ‘hearing a death rattle.’ I’m not dying and I’m not dead.”</p>
<p>In fact, after six months’ chemotherapy, a double mastectomy, a hysterectomy and an infection that hospitalized her last week, Ross is so not dead that she’s juggling several major projects.</p>

<title>ABC News Pours The Champagne to Celebrate First &#8216;GMA&#8217; Weekly Win Since 1995</title>
<description><![CDATA[<p><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-123531" title="ABCGMA3" src="http://www.mediabistro.com/tvnewser/files/2012/04/ABCGMA3.jpg" alt="" width="511" height="379" /><br />
<span style="color: #888888;">(l-r) ABC News SVP James Goldston, Josh Elliott, Robin Roberts, ABC News president Ben Sherwood, George Stephanopoulos, Sam Champion, Lara Spencer, GMA EP Tom Cibrowski</span></p>
<p>More than 200 ABC News staffers packed the 5th floor newsroom this morning for a <a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/tvnewser/good-morning-america-breaks-today-shows-16-year-winning-streak_b123185">toast and celebration</a> of &#8220;Good Morning America&#8221; breaking the &#8220;Today&#8221; show&#8217;s winning streak that lasted 16 years and 16 weeks.</p>
<p>ABC News president <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Ben-Sherwood-profile.html">Ben Sherwood</a></strong>, who was executive producer of the show when it came within striking distance in 2005, gave two toasts: first to his colleagues at NBC, acknowledging the streak, and a second to his team and all those who came before, including former longtime executives <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/David-Westin-profile.html">David Westin</a></strong>, <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Jim-Murphy-profile.html">Jim Murphy</a></strong>, <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Phyllis-McGrady-profile.html">Phyllis McGrady</a></strong> and <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Shelley-Ross-profile.html">Shelley Ross</a></strong>, who was EP of the show for more than five years, beginning in 1999.</p>
<p>One longtime ABCNewser emailed, &#8220;The energy in the building is electric.&#8221; Sherwood, who first joined ABC News in 1989 talked about how before the streak, &#8220;We&#8217;d win a week, they&#8217;d win a week, then we&#8217;d win.&#8221; The back-and-forth ended on Dec. 11, 1995 when &#8220;Today&#8221; began its until-now unbroken 852-week winning streak. Sherwood himself jumped to NBC News in 1997 working on &#8220;Nightly News&#8221; before returning to ABC to oversee &#8220;GMA&#8221; in 2004. Sherwood talked about how many of the the show&#8217;s current staffers were in junior high or high school in 1995. News anchor <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Josh-Elliott-profile.html">Josh Elliott</a></strong> had just graduated from college.</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Diane-Sawyer-profile.html">Diane Sawyer</a></strong> and <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Chris-Cuomo-profile.html">Chris Cuomo</a></strong>, former anchors on the show were in attendance while the current team of <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Robin-Roberts-profile.html">Robin Roberts</a></strong>, <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/George-Stephanopoulos-profile.html">George Stephanopoulos</a></strong>, <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Sam-Champion-profile.html">Sam Champion</a></strong>, <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Lara-Spencer-profile.html">Lara Spencer</a></strong> and Elliott said a few words.</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/James-Goldston-profile.html">James Goldston</a></strong> who oversees the show as SVP, as well as Senior EP <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Tom-Cibrowski-profile.html">Tom Cibrowski</a></strong> also spoke. There was a lot of hugging, an insider tells us.</p>

<title>Changes May Be Coming to &#8216;The Early Show&#8217;</title>
<description><![CDATA[<p><img alt="Shalev_12.4.jpg" src="/tvnewser/files/original/Shalev_12.4.jpg" width="194" class="alignleft" vspace="6" hspace="3" />TVNewser has learned CBS News boss <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Sean-McManus-profile.html">Sean McManus</a></strong> may be making a change atop his morning show.</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Zev-Shalev-profile.html">Zev Shalev</a></strong>, who has been EP of &#8220;The Early Show&#8221; since June 2008, may soon be out the door. Multiple sources tell TVNewser that, while Shalev is still on the job, a search is on for his replacement.</p>
<p>We&#8217;re told the move may be timed to take advantage of the anchor changes at &#8220;Good Morning America.&#8221; &#8220;The Early Show&#8221; has been stuck in third place behind #1 the &#8220;Today&#8221; show and #2 ABC&#8217;s GMA since at least 1987, when people meters began.</p>
<p>Shalev was <a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/tvnewser/the_revolving_door/the_early_show_names_senior_broadcast_producer_79799.asp">brought on</a> as a senior producer in March 2008 by then-interim EP <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Rick-Kaplan-profile.html">Rick Kaplan</a></strong> who had <a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/tvnewser/cbs/shelley_ross_leaves_early_show_rick_kaplan_to_take_over_78898.asp">taken over the show</a> after the brief stint of <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Shelley-Ross-profile.html">Shelley Ross</a></strong>.</p>
<p>A CBS News spokesperson tells TVNewser, &#8220;We don&#8217;t comment on rumors. The fact is, we are extremely pleased with the quality and growth of &#8216;The Early Show&#8217; and look forward to the change in the competitive landscape in January.&#8221;</p>

<title>Shalev: &#8220;I&#8217;d Rather Be In Third And Growing Than In Second And Dropping&#8221;</title>
<description><![CDATA[<p><img alt="shalev_6-17.jpg" src="/tvnewser/files/original/shalev_6-17.jpg" width="156" height="182" class="alignleft" vspace="3" hspace="5" />The New York Observer&#8217;s <b>Felix Gillette</b> spent a rainy Friday at the U.S.S. Intrepid last week for <a href="http://www.observer.com/2009/media/zen-art-zev-shalev" target="_blank">a profile of</a> The Early Show EP <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Zev-Shalev-profile.html">Zev Shalev</a></strong>.</p>
<p>He talked about the gains made by the 3rd place network morning show. &#8220;I&#8217;d rather be in third and growing than in second and dropping,&#8221; he said. &#8220;There&#8217;s less pressure. We have the luxury of experimenting.&#8221;</p>
<p>Shalev, who was born in Israel and raised in South Africa, said of foreign coverage: &#8220;Sometimes I think American media can be very shut off from the rest of the world. There are a lot of interesting stories out there. You just have to find the right way in.&#8221;</p>
<p>Shalev talked about the calm and good attitude at the CBS program now, after <a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/tvnewser/cbs/early_exit_for_shelley_ross_78773.asp" target="_blank">a tumultuous time</a> before he took over. Or, as Gillette describes it, &#8220;the ghost of <strong><a href="http://www.mediabistro.com/Shelley-Ross-profile.html">Shelley Ross</a></strong> felt long since exorcised.&#8221;</p>
<p>Said Shalev, &#8220;I think that we have a real spirit now that is terrific.&#8221;</p>
